Grow Room Humidity Control: Targets by Stage and the Kit That Holds Them

Grow room humidity control means holding relative humidity (RH) inside a stage-specific band: roughly 65-80% for seedlings and clones, 50-70% in veg, 40-50% in early flower, then 30-40% in late flower. You hold those numbers with three levers — extraction, a dehumidifier and a humidifier — backed by steady air movement. Lower RH as plants mature to keep mould and bud rot out of dense flowers.
Humidity is the quiet half of grow-room climate: RH decides how fast plants drink and whether roots or mould win the flowering stretch. Get it wrong and you either stall young plants or hand a summer heatwave the damp, still air grey mould loves.

What humidity should a grow tent be at each stage?
A grow tent's ideal humidity falls as the plant matures — high for rootless seedlings, dry and airy for dense flowers. Measure RH at canopy height and walk it down stage by stage.
| Stage | Target RH | Why |
|---|---|---|
| Seedling / clone | 65-80% | Weak roots drink little; leaves need moist air |
| Vegetative | 50-70% | Roots take over uptake; drop RH as the canopy fills |
| Early flower | 40-50% | Buds forming; lower RH steers growth, guards against mould |
| Late flower / ripening | 30-40% | Dense flowers most vulnerable; dry, moving air prevents bud rot |
These bands line up across grow-equipment makers (AC Infinity, Mars Hydro, Spider Farmer) and standard horticulture guidance. Treat them as targets, not tightropes: brief excursions won't hurt, but sitting far outside the band for days will — especially high RH in flower.
One number worth remembering: a plant releases 97-99.5% of the water its roots take up straight back into the air as vapour, mostly through transpiration (a trace escapes via guttation) (Modern Plant Physiology, via Wikipedia). That is why a well-watered tent turns humid so fast, and why humidity control is really moisture management once the canopy fills out.
Why does grow room humidity spike — especially in summer?
Humidity spikes because plants are moisture pumps and warm air holds more water. Two things stack up in summer.
First, RH climbs when the tent cools. Relative humidity is relative to temperature — the same water vapour reads higher in cooler air. So the moment lights switch off and the tent drops a few degrees, RH jumps, often by 10-20 points, though nothing was added. Lights-off is exactly when cool, damp, still air meets peak bud-rot risk.
Second, UK summer air is often already humid. A muggy warm front means your intake air carries more moisture to begin with, so extraction has less headroom to dump what plants transpire.

How do I lower humidity in a grow tent?
To lower humidity, remove moist air faster than plants add it — extraction first, then a dehumidifier if extraction alone can't hold the target:
- Turn up extraction. Your inline exhaust fan pulls damp air out and drags drier air in; a speed-controllable one pushes harder on humid nights. It's your cheapest lever — kit you already run.
- Add air movement. An oscillating or clip fan breaks up the still, humid pockets in the canopy and against the walls, where mould starts.
- Water smarter. Water early in lights-on, clear standing runoff, and don't overwater. Less free water means less to evaporate.
- Run a dehumidifier. When extraction is maxed and RH still won't drop — common in late veg and flower — it removes water directly to a set target.
A dehumidifier earns its place in flower most, when the target is lowest (30-40%) and mould risk highest. Site it inside the tent or the surrounding "lung room" it breathes from.
How do I raise humidity in a grow tent?
To raise humidity, add moisture with a humidifier and ease off extraction so you're not pulling it back out — mainly an early-grow job. Seedlings and fresh clones have almost no working roots, so they drink through their leaves and need 65-80% RH to avoid stalling.
- Run a humidifier sized to the space, ideally one that reads RH and switches off at target.
- Use a humidity dome or propagator over seedlings and cuttings to trap moisture locally.
- Turn extraction to minimum during propagation, since aggressive venting strips the humidity you're building.
Once roots establish and the canopy drinks properly, the job flips from adding moisture to removing it.
Dehumidifier, extraction or humidifier — which do I actually need?
Most UK growers need all three levers across a cycle, rarely at once. Match the tool to the job:
| Tool | What it does | Reach for it when | Watch-out |
|---|---|---|---|
| Extraction (inline fan) | Swaps humid tent air for drier room air; also removes heat and odour | First move at any stage; RH slightly high | Can't dry below your intake air's humidity — a muggy-summer limit |
| Dehumidifier | Pulls water directly from the air to a set RH | Late veg and flower; RH won't drop despite good extraction | Adds heat and uses power; empty or plumb the tank |
| Humidifier | Adds moisture to the air | Seedlings, clones, early veg; RH too low | Overshooting invites mould; pair with a humidistat |
| Air circulator | Keeps air moving so no damp pockets form | Always on, every stage | Aim across the canopy, not at it |
The honest rule of thumb: fix airflow before you buy a box. A correctly sized extraction fan plus a circulator solves humidity for many small UK tents; a dehumidifier or humidifier tops up the stages airflow can't reach. What size dehumidifier do I need for a grow tent?
Size a dehumidifier to your tent's footprint and how much you feed — bigger canopy, more water in, more to pull back out. Grow-market units are rated in US pints per day, UK domestic units usually in litres per day, so both are shown below.
| Tent size | Suggested dehumidifier capacity |
|---|---|
| 60 × 60 cm (2 × 2 ft) | ~9-14 L/day (20-30 US pints/day) |
| 1.2 × 1.2 m (4 × 4 ft) | ~14-24 L/day (30-50 US pints/day) |
| 1.5 × 1.5 m (5 × 5 ft) | ~24-33 L/day (50-70 US pints/day) |
Figures follow grow-equipment sizing guidance (Gorilla Grow Tent, Trimleaf). Two notes for UK growers. First, plants do most of the work — a mature 4 × 4 ft canopy can transpire on the order of 4-8 litres (1-2 gallons) of water vapour a day, which the dehumidifier has to match. Second, size up about 25-30% for a dense canopy, a humid room, or drying flowers in the space. A small 60 × 60 cm (2 × 2 ft) or 80 × 80 cm (2.6 × 2.6 ft) tent with good extraction often needs no dehumidifier at all.
Does high humidity really cause mould and bud rot?
Yes — high humidity is the single biggest driver of mould, and dense flowers are the prime target. Two problems dominate, both humidity-led:
- Grey mould / bud rot (Botrytis cinerea) is the serious one — it rots buds from the inside and spreads fast. It is favoured by cool, damp, still air above roughly 85% RH; actual spore germination needs prolonged leaf wetness — on the order of 8-12 hours — at very high humidity (around 93%+) and cool temperatures of about 13-18°C (55-65°F): precisely the damp, lights-off flowering environment to avoid. Keeping flowering RH below about 50% sharply cuts the risk.
- Powdery mildew coats leaves in white dust and is favoured by RH above roughly 55-60%, even without free water on the leaf. Holding veg toward the lower end of its 50-70% band and flower at 40-50% keeps it in check.
Because dense flowers trap moisture in their cores, a bud's interior sits far wetter than your canopy meter reads. So the flowering strategy is dry and moving air: low RH removes the fuel, a circulator kills the still pockets where spores settle. Steady beats see-sawing — the lights-off spike is when infections take hold.
FAQ
What humidity should a grow tent be in flower? Aim for 40-50% RH in early flower, dropping to 30-40% in the final couple of weeks. Lower humidity steers dense buds away from grey mould and encourages resin production. Keep air moving with a circulation fan so no damp pockets form.
Is 60% humidity too high for flowering? For flowering, yes — 60% is higher than ideal. Early flower wants 40-50% and late flower 30-40%. Sustained RH near or above 60% in dense buds raises the risk of grey mould (Botrytis), which is favoured once humidity climbs above about 85%. Bring it down with extraction and a dehumidifier.
What size dehumidifier do I need for a 4x4 grow tent? Roughly 14-24 litres per day (about 30-50 US pints per day) suits a 1.2 × 1.2 m (4 × 4 ft) tent, depending on canopy density and how humid your room is. Size up around 25-30% if you run a full canopy or dry flowers in the same space.
